Run Medford Returns Sept. 27 and 28 With 5-mile, 5K, 2-mile and Track Festival

June 7, 2024

Third annual event in Dave McGillivray’s hometown marks return with relaunch of popular distances, special offers for its eldest competitors, and more

MEDFORD, Mass./ENDURANCE SPORTSWIRE/ – For the third year in a row, Run Medford will be taking to the streets and the track for a variety of running and walking events on Sept. 27 and 28. This race series is a key fundrainsing event for the Dave McGillivray Finish Strong Foundation with support from DMSE Sports. Starting and finishing at Medford City Hall, the 5-mile run, 5K run, and 2-mile walk are scenic tours through McGillivray’s hometown. In addition, there will be a track festival on Friday night featuring kids’ fun runs, the Mayor’s Celebrity Mile, a parathlete mile and high school miles at the Dave McGillivray Track at Hormel Stadium. Registration is now open for all distances.

This year, the Dave McGillivray Finish Strong Foundation will donate funds raised by the event to causes benefiting local students in Medford schools. Past beneficiaries have included Charlotte and William Bloomberg Medford Public Library, Power Kids Summer Enrichment Program, Medford Parks And Recreation Program, Medford Senior Center and the Center For Citizenship And Social Responsibility At Medford High School.

Back by popular demand, the 5K distance has been added back to the weekend’s lineup. The 5K is named in honor of Jerry Panarese, who was a member of the New England 65+ Runners Club. Panarese was the director of the Run of All Ages for 25 years. This race was going to end, and the foundation and DMSE teams decided to include it in this year’s Run Medford event to keep Panarese’s spirit alive.

This year, the race is aiming to expand its master’s field of runners by allowing participants over the age of 80 to register for the 5K at no cost. The goal is to create the largest field of 80+ runners in a 5K race in the country, further cementing the “All Ages” namesake of the 5K.

All participants receive Medford-themed swag including finish medals and t-shirts featuring the blue Mustang mascot of Medford High School. Finishers also receive copies of McGillivray’s book “Running Across America, A True Story of Dreams, Determination and Heading for Home” – which tells the tale of his Medford, Ore. to Medford, Mass. run across the nation.

ABOUT DMSE SPORTS

DMSE Sports is a full-service event-management organization, providing a full range of event and race production, management, and consulting services to support events of all sizes. Dave McGillivray and his team at DMSE Sports are responsible for the technical and logistical aspects of more than 30 races and walks per year. From overseeing organizing committees to working with local officials and handling registration, credentialing, lead vehicles, and course setup, DMSE Sports does it all. The firm has produced more than 1,600 events since opening its doors in 1981 and serves clients throughout the United States. ABOUT THE DAVE MCGILLIVRAY FINISH STRONG FOUNDATION

The Dave McGillivray Finish Strong Foundation seeks to inspire and empower youth across New England and beyond to increase physical activity, expand literacy, and build community and self-esteem through running, reading, and performing acts of kindness. Their vision is rooted in a belief that discovering a passion for physical activity, reading, and acts of kindness at a young age gives individuals self-confidence and self-respect, which empowers them to move forward—one step at a time. For over eighteen years, the foundation has remained committed to preparing individuals for future success and building vibrant communities.
